Donald R. Massey

Two Rivers, Wisconsin - Donald R. Massey died peacefully August 7, holding the hand of his wife, Helen. They celebrated their 67th wedding anniversary in June, and his 92nd birthday in July.

Don lives on in the hearts and memories of his wife Helen, his children Daniel, Michele (Ed) Schrader, Mark, Pat (Mike) Wiegert, Stephen (Mary), Veronica (Rick) Armstrong, Laura (Mark) Morrow, Susan (Gary) Nickel, Paul (Tanya), Zilton (Angelica) Neves, his brothers Russell (Darleen) and David (Karen), many grandchildren, great-grandchildren, nieces and nephews. He also had many "adopted" children and close family friends.

Please join us for Don's celebration of life on Saturday, August 21 at St. Peter the Fisherman in Two Rivers. The family will greet guests from 9:30 with the service starting at 11:00. Comfortable attire, especially orange or plaid shirts, is encouraged.

Special thanks to Meadow View Assisted Living for putting up with Don's antics, and to Sharon S. Richardson Community Hospice for their guidance and care.

As he requested, Don's earthly remains have been donated to the UW Body Donor Program.

If you would like to make a memorial donation, please consider St. Peter the Fisherman, Woodland Dunes, or Sharon S. Richardson Community Hospice.

The Klein & Stangel Funeral Home, Two Rivers is assisting the Massey family with funeral arrangements.
